嵌入式工程师的职业发展路径是怎样的?
在当今信息化时代,嵌入式工程师成为了技术领域的重要角色。他们负责设计和开发嵌入式系统,这些系统广泛应用于智能家居、工业自动化、医疗设备等领域。那么,嵌入式工程师的职业发展路径是怎样的呢?本文将为您详细解析。
一、嵌入式工程师的职业发展初期
基础知识储备:嵌入式工程师需要掌握C/C++、汇编语言等编程语言,熟悉计算机组成原理、操作系统、数据结构等基础知识。
项目实践:通过参与实际项目,积累经验,了解嵌入式系统的设计、开发、调试等流程。
技能提升:学习硬件电路设计、嵌入式系统架构、通信协议等方面的知识,提高自己的综合素质。
二、嵌入式工程师的职业发展阶段
初级工程师:在项目实践中,积累经验,熟悉各种嵌入式开发工具和平台,具备独立完成项目的能力。
中级工程师:具备丰富的项目经验,能够独立负责项目,具备团队协作和项目管理能力。
高级工程师:具备丰富的技术积累和项目经验,能够带领团队完成复杂项目,具备一定的技术创新能力。
三、嵌入式工程师的职业发展路径
技术方向:
- 嵌入式软件开发:专注于嵌入式系统软件的开发,如驱动程序、中间件、应用软件等。
- 嵌入式硬件设计:专注于嵌入式系统硬件的设计,如电路设计、PCB设计、FPGA设计等。
- 嵌入式系统架构:专注于嵌入式系统的整体架构设计,如系统性能优化、资源分配等。
管理方向:
- 项目经理:负责项目的整体规划、进度控制、资源协调等。
- 技术经理:负责团队的技术指导、技术培训、技术攻关等。
- 产品经理:负责产品的需求分析、设计、研发等。
四、案例分析
技术方向:
- 华为海思:海思是全球领先的半导体公司,专注于移动通信、视频监控、智能家居等领域。海思的嵌入式工程师在技术方向上有着广阔的发展空间。
管理方向:
- 小米:小米是一家全球领先的互联网公司,其嵌入式工程师在管理方向上有着丰富的职业发展路径,如项目经理、技术经理等。
五、总结
嵌入式工程师的职业发展路径多样,既有技术方向,也有管理方向。在职业发展过程中,不断学习、积累经验、提升技能是关键。希望本文能为嵌入式工程师的职业发展提供一定的参考。
猜你喜欢:猎头如何快速推人